We were proud to take part in Go Purple Day, an event organised by An Garda Síochána in partnership with domestic abuse services across Ireland.
This powerful initiative raises awareness of domestic abuse and brings communities together in solidarity with individuals who have experienced abuse.
A sincere thank you to the Gardaí in Boyle for bringing us all together in support of such an important cause.
We appreciated the peaceful walk through Bluebell Woods, followed by a lovely gathering with refreshments at Ardcarne Garden Centre.
Events like this play a vital role in breaking the silence around domestic abuse, offering hope, and reminding people they are not alone.
